SAP Knowledge Base Article - Public

2983624 - JSONObject["userId"] not found error when run Employee Central Imports or SF OData API Upsert


If you are running Employee Central Imports or SF OData API Upsert or ERP Migration (HCM to EC) and you got the error message “JSONObject["userId"] not found” in the Job Information upsert (EmpJob).


  • SAP SuccessFactors Employee Central
  • SAP SuccessFactors Odata API


Please check your EC business rules. If you are not sure which rule validate/trigger this, please disable all the rules and test again.


JSONObject, userId, not found, employee import, upsert , KBA , LOD-SF-INT , Integrations , LOD-SF-INT-ODATA , OData API Framework , LOD-SF-INT-EC , Employee Central SFAPI & OData Entities , LOD-EC-INT-TLS , ERP On Premise to EC and EC-ERP Integration Tools , Problem


SAP SuccessFactors HCM suite all versions